My husband and I want to take our 3 young children (ages 7, 5, and 3) camping for the first time over summer vacation (June/July). We live in Stockton, California and to not want to drive more than 2-3 hours. I have been to Yosemite several times and think my children would enjoy it more when thay are a little older. I have also been to Calaveras Big Trees several times and like it, but I want to try someplace new. Any suggestions?


Answer
If you are tent camping or a cabover close to your area is a pretty 10 site campground at kirkwood. A small lake for the kids to fish. hiking is great. I like lake almanor for a big rig. Nice paved bike and walking trails. Deer come to join you for breakfast. Bucks lake and little grass valley are nice for that time of year. both at 5200 feet and cooler than the valley. I am a ritired camp manager and love to see familkies spend quality time together camping. Have a great time where ever you decide.

I'm a nanny for 3 boys ages 5, 8, and 9. I pick them up from school and the parents want me to take them somewhere fun until dinner time. I think the kids are getting tired of going to the park or library everyday. What are some other ideas of things to do??


Answer
You can go bowling, ice skating, roller skating, play tennis, catch, walk through botanical gardens or children's museums, go to the zoo (get a family membership), play "Mother May I" or "Green Light Red Light". Also, set up playdates with their friends, have them walk a neighbor's dog, visit the elderly at a retirement community, go bike riding. Also, you could have them get some photos together and have them make a scrap book at a scrapbook store. They have all the supplies and will help them with their ideas. You may have to go there many times over a few week span to get it completed. This could be a gift for Mother's Day. Don't forget to ask them what they're interested in doing after school.
